「フォルダを選択してからメール一覧を表No.13918
douch さん 03/07/24 10:16
 
「全体的な設定」→「フォルダ」内の、「フォルダを選択してからメール
一覧を表示するまで少し間を置く」をチェックしている場合の挙動に関し
て、バグではないかとと思われる内容がありますので、修正をお願い致し
ます。

フォルダ枠でカーソルを上、もしくは下に押しっぱなしにして、目的のフ
ォルダに着いたらカーソルを離します。すると、一瞬間が空いてから、次
のフォルダへ移動してしまうのです。
上記オプションをオフにしているときには、この挙動は起きません。

しばらく自分の操作がおかしいのかと疑ってましたが、オプションオフで
気付きました。目的のフォルダに移動するのが面倒になる場合があるので、
修正をお願い致します。

Win2000SP3+IE6

[ ]
RE:13918 「フォルダを選択してからメールNo.13920
秀まるお2 さん 03/07/24 10:59
 
 僕もテストのために普段はそこのオプションをONにしていますが、連絡いただ
いたような症状は起きないです。

 つまり、単純にカーソル上下移動キーを押しっぱなしにして離してフォルダが
確定し、そこのメール一覧が表示されてからさらに1つとなりのフォルダが選択
されるような症状は起きません。

 キーリピートの開始時間をいじったり、秀Capsのカーソル移動加速をON/OFFす
るなどしても再現しないです。

 douchさんの所では、常に症状が起きるのでしょうか。あるいは、一度も選択
してないフォルダを選択した場合に限って起きるとか。何かもうちょっと条件を
教えて欲しいです。

---------
 これとは別に、カーソル上下移動キーを押して離して押して離して…っと操作
した場合に、目的のフォルダから1つ分行きすぎてしまうことは時々あります。
これについては直したいと思いつつも、根本的に、フォルダを選択した時のメー
ル一覧の生成に時間がかかる分にはどうにもならないかと思って、今のところ放
置してます。

 フォルダ選択からの遅延時間をもうちょっと長めにすればかなり回避できます
が、それはそれで待ち時間が長くていらいらします。

 メール一覧を作成している最中にもキー入力を監視して、メール一覧の作成を
途中でやめるような処理を作ろうかと思ったんですが、それはそれで大がかりな
修正になるので、またレベルダウンが起きて怖いかなぁと思います。

[ ]
RE:13920 「フォルダを選択してからメールNo.13921
douch さん 03/07/24 11:51
 
回答ありがとうございます。

> 僕もテストのために普段はそこのオプションをONにしていますが、連絡いただ
>いたような症状は起きないです。
> つまり、単純にカーソル上下移動キーを押しっぱなしにして離してフォルダが
>確定し、そこのメール一覧が表示されてからさらに1つとなりのフォルダが選択
>されるような症状は起きません。

すいません、正確に書きますね。

カーソル上下キーを押しっぱなしにして、あるフォルダ上で離します。
すると、このオプションの「少しの間」を置いた後、カーソル移動方向
の次のフォルダに移り、同じタイミングでメール一覧が表示されます。
このとき表示されるメール一覧は、最終的に選ばれているフォルダのも
のです。

長くなってしまいますが、具体的に書きます。

[フォルダA]

・(この間フォルダ有り)

[フォルダB]
[フォルダC]
[フォルダD]




上の様にフォルダが並んでいて、最初[フォルダA]にフォーカスがある
状態で、↓カーソルキーを押しっぱなしにします。

[フォルダC]上にフォーカスが来たときに、カーソルを離します。する
と、このオプションの「少しの間」の間は、[フォルダC]上にフォーカ
スがあり(その間は一覧は[フォルダA]の内容)、その「少しの間」が終
了した後に、[フォルダD]にフォーカスが突然移り、一覧は[フォルダD]
の内容を表示します。


> キーリピートの開始時間をいじったり、秀Capsのカーソル移動加速をON/OFFす
>るなどしても再現しないです。

キーリピートの開始時間はいじってませんし、カーソル移動速度もいじ
っていません。Windowsのデフォルトのままだと思われます。そういうカ
スタマイズソフトもインストールしていません。


> douchさんの所では、常に症状が起きるのでしょうか。あるいは、一度も選択
>してないフォルダを選択した場合に限って起きるとか。何かもうちょっと条件を
>教えて欲しいです。

カーソルキーのキーリピートが効いた状態であれば、ほぼ再現します。
フォルダは関係ありません。フォルダも階層であろうと並列に並んでい
ようと畳まれていようと再現します。
ただし、10回に1回くらい再現しないことがあります。条件がよくわから
ないのですが、何か気付いたら投稿するようにします。(ただ、この場合
は、「少しの間」もうまく動作していないように見受けられるのですが)

鶴亀メールのバージョンは、2.97〜3.01まで全てで再現します。
他に何か調査必要な内容があったら御指示下さい。


> これとは別に、カーソル上下移動キーを押して離して押して離して…っと操作
>した場合に、目的のフォルダから1つ分行きすぎてしまうことは時々あります。
>これについては直したいと思いつつも、根本的に、フォルダを選択した時のメー
>ル一覧の生成に時間がかかる分にはどうにもならないかと思って、今のところ放
>置してます。

これは多分発生したことないと思います。カーソルキーをすぐに離せば、
予想通りの動作をします。


Win2000SP3+IE6,鶴亀メール3.01

[ ]
RE:13921 「フォルダを選択してからメールNo.13922
秀まるお2 さん 03/07/24 12:46
 
 10回に9回程度の頻度で発生するんですか。

 うちの会社にいくつかテスト環境があるので、あちこちでテストしてみます。
どうしても再現しなければ、可能性的に考えて適当な対策など入れてみます。

[ ]
RE:13922 「フォルダを選択してからメールNo.13923
秀まるお2 さん 03/07/24 13:18
 
 連絡いただ情報とソースコードを比較した結果、単に画面の描画が1テンポ遅
れてるだけのような気がします。つまり、実際には[フォルダD]が選択されてい
るのに、画面の描画が1つ前のままになっていて、[フォルダC]が選択されてる
ように見えるだけという…。

 独自にメッセージループしてる所があって、そこでWM_PAINTやWM_NCPAINTを通
してるつもりが、条件によってはうまくDispatchされないのかもと思いまして…。

 そういう前提で修正させていただきます。&早めにバージョンアップしたいの
で、β版ということでアップロードします。

[ ]
RE:13923 「フォルダを選択してからメールNo.13924
秀まるお2 さん 03/07/24 14:20
 
 ということでアップロードしました。お時間のある時にでも確認お願いします。

  http://www.hidemaru.interlink.or.jp/software/bin/tk302b1.exe

[ ]
RE:13924 「フォルダを選択してからメールNo.13927
douch さん 03/07/24 15:31
 
> ということでアップロードしました。お時間のある時にでも確認お願いします。

私の状態を再現できないのに、素早い対応ありがとうございます。
1時間近く使用しているところでは、問題ありません。改善されたと思います。

ありがとうございましたm(__)m

[ ]